Employer Alert: The Minimum Salary Levels for White Collar Employees Increases to $35k on January 1, 2020
The United States Department of Labor (“DOL”) issued a final rule on September 24, 2019, that raises the minimum salary threshold to $684 per week ($35,568 annually) for exempt “white collar” employees. In general, the white collar exemptions allow...
